Recap / The A Team S 3 E 12 Hot Styles

Go To

Face's latest romance with a model named Rina is rudely interrupted when a couple of gangsters, led by Johnny Turian, pull her away during a date — but even stranger is her resistance when the team rescues her. Although Hannibal wonders if this is simply a part of her life she didn't share with Face, the team learns otherwise when they investigate the situation further. In his attempt to steal a set of highly-guarded fashion designs, Turian will stop at nothing, and Rina's life isn't the only one in danger.

This episode includes examples of the following tropes:

  • Batman Gambit: The team's plan to defeat Turian involves giving him a bunch of fake designs in place of the real fashions he plans on ripping off. The original plan is to have Rina, who is supposed to be delivering the stolen designs to Turian, swap those out with the fakes. Face realizes that whatever Turian has on her has her completely under the villain's sway and that she'll certainly rat the team out again... so he doesn't make the swap, but tells her he did, resulting in Turian destroying the real designs and sending the fakes to his boss after all.
  • Complaining About Rescues They Don't Like: A large part of the plot revolves around the Damsel in Distress's unwillingness to let Face and his friends save her. It turns out the villain is also holding her young son, and she's afraid he'll be hurt if she tries to escape.
  • Cover Innocent Eyes and Ears: Rina covers her young son Eric's eyes briefly while Face and the other two are punching out Turian and his men.
  • False Reassurance: When Rina begs Turian not to hurt Face, Turian tells her he's not going to; the sharks are.
  • Gratuitous Spanish: Murdock calls Hannibal El Jefe ("the boss") in one scene.
  • Hypocrite: Face complains about Rina leading him on when she was really dating Turian. Hannibal points out that he didn't tell her he was a fugitive from the government. Rina also calls Face out on it... at which point he calls her out as well.
  • I Have Your Daughter: Gender Flipped; Face can't understand why Rina keeps resisting his efforts to rescue her, until the two of them are aboard Turian's yacht and Turian's men bring out a little boy — Rina's son Eric.
  • I Know You Know I Know: When Turian gloats to Face that he's already too late to stop him from stealing the designs, Face reveals that he suspected Rina would be frightened enough to inform on him and hence he didn't replace the film. Turian sent the decoy roll with Murdock's designs to his boss and tossed the real roll into the harbor.
  • Pop the Tires: Turian shoots out the front tire of Face's Corvette to stop him from chasing them.
  • Preemptive Apology: Just before leaving the yacht, Hannibal apologizes for the hole in it. When Turian asks what hole he means, Hannibal holds up a grenade.
  • Spoiled by the Format: The team finds the antagonists and rescues the girl a short way into the episode, so obviously something else will have to be wrong to fill up the remaining minutes.
  • Title Drop: When working on their plan, Hannibal promises to deliver some "hot styles" in place of the fashions Turian is trying to rip off.
  • Watch the Paint Job: The others somehow talked B.A. into letting Murdock drive his precious van while he's getting there and a Running Gag through the episode is the worry that something will happen to it. Strangely, except for a few moments early in the episode, Murdock takes this charge very seriously, worrying about odd sounds and keeping the heat on high to keep the carpet fluffy. Of course, all this is ruined when Murdock accidentally drives the van off a dock at the end of the episode.
  • You Are Too Late: Thinking that Face wants to get back the fashion designs, Turian gloats that he's too late; Turian already mailed the film to his boss. However, Face then reveals that he tricked Turian into mailing the wrong film.
  • You Have Outlived Your Usefulness: Once Rina has gotten the fashion designs for him, Turian tells his men to throw her, her son, and Face overboard.
